Darigold will pay $2 million to settle a lawsuit filed by Columbia Riverkeeper accusing it of discharging too much pollution from its milk processing plant in Sunnyside, Wash. Darigold will make the payment to the Yakama Nation to fund water-quality projects, according to the settlement, which must be approved by U.S. District Judge Rebecca Pennell in Spokane.
